Teaching Assistant Level 2 job summary
We are seeking to appoint a caring andenthusiastic Teaching Assistant to support our children. The successfulcandidate will have an appropriate qualification at NVQ Level 2 or above andthe experience to support children.
It is expected that the candidate willhave recent experience working in educational settings. There will be anexpectation to complete paperwork, attend meetings and support the ClassTeacher. The successful applicant will be a flexible team player, committed toraising standards and meeting the needs of our children as they move across theschool and support the Catholic ethos of the school.
You must have the followingqualifications:
GCSE Maths and English (Grade A-C) orequivalent
NVQ Level 3 Teaching Assistantqualification or equivalent
The School is committed to safeguardingand promoting the welfare of children and expects all staff to share thiscommitment.
Applicants must be willing to undergochild protection screening appropriate to the post, including checks with pastemployers and the Disclosure and Barring Scheme. CVs will not be accepted forany posts based in schools. St Margarets are Equal OpportunityEmployers.
